Job Summary
The Associate Bursar provides direct supervision of the Student Accounts Office while monitoring tuition and fee collections.
This role involves counseling students and families on financing options, managing financial clearance, and ensuring compliance with policies.
The position requires a candidate with a Bachelor's degree and at least five years of experience in accounts receivable and customer service.
